The ETH-USD has been in a Bear Market ever since January 2018, correcting the previous multi-year Bull Market. It seems to be correcting as a Double Three Correction, elliottwave-forecast...elliott-wave-theory/ , of which we already trace Cycle Wave W, Cycle Wave X, and are currently tracing Cycle Wave Y, which starts at the June 2019 highs, around $364 dollars. I will explain the last Cycle Wave Y in detail later, here is the overall Long-Term Elliott Wave Count:


Cycle Wave Y, subdivides into 3 smaller waves: Primary Wave A, B & C. Of which we already trace Primary Wave A, B and are currently tracing Primary Wave C which subdivides into 5 smaller waves, Intermediate Wave 1,2,3,4 & 5. Of which we already trace Intermediate Wave 1 and 2 and are currently tracing Intermediate Wave 3. Yet also missing Intermediate Waves 4 and 5 to complete this Long-Term, Multi-Year, Super-Cycle Bear Market. Meaning we may still have a few months to finish going down, and we should also break down below the $80 USD mark, a good guess for me would probably be the $40 USD mark, and around Mid-April to finish going down.

Of course, I don’t know the future, and this is not the only possible scenario, but, is the one I’m envision and presenting in here.
